Is Headband the Indica? Exploring those Origins

Determining whether Headband is primarily an Indica or Sativa strain can be tricky, as it's often considered a mixed variety. While its lineage isn’t perfectly documented, the generally accepted story points to a blend of OG Kush and Durban Poison genetics. OG Kush, known for its calming effects and potent scent profile, leans towards the Indica side, contributing to Headband's heavy body high and potential for drowsiness. Durban Poison, however, is a pure Sativa strain celebrated for its energizing qualities. This creates a unique genetic tapestry. Many cultivators describe Headband as having predominantly Indica characteristics due to the stronger influence of OG Kush, with a reported 60/40 or even 70/30 Indica dominance. However, the Sativa component still provides a touch of cerebral clarity and energy that prevents it from being entirely couch-locking. Headband Strain Terpenes: A Deep Exploration into Aroma and Effects

The captivating scent and distinctive effects of Headband cannabis are largely attributable to its terpene profile . This popular hybrid boasts a complex array of aromatic compounds, primarily featuring Myrcene , known for its earthy, musky notes that contribute significantly to the strain’s relaxing properties. Alongside Myrcene, Limonene plays a prominent role, lending a bright, citrusy fragrance and potentially uplifting effects; this can enhance mood and reduce stress. Furthermore, the presence of Alpha-Pinene , with its pine-like aroma reminiscent of fresh forests, is also commonly reported, suggesting potential cognitive benefits like improved focus and memory. Together, these terpenes – and potentially lesser amounts of Carene and others – create the unique sensory experience and overall effects associated with Headband, making understanding their individual roles crucial for appreciating this highly sought-after variety.
